An antique, natural wood, vermilion lacquered, extra-large bowl (Oohira-wan / Ume-wan / Nimono-wan). It shows wear and tear commensurate with its age. (The lid has four chips in places that are not visible when the lid is closed.) The fine annual rings visible when held up to the light suggest that it was made from a single large plank of wood. It would be wonderful for serving chirashizushi, as a confectionery bowl, as a substitute for an ohitsu (rice container), or for displaying small items. Size: ・Diameter Bowl body: Approximately 30 cm ・Height Without lid: Approximately 9 cm It appears to have been used for celebrations when a large number of people gathered.
